IP Address
A type of network adapter address used when multiple networks are linked. Known as a Layer 3 address, in IPv4 it is a 32-bit binary number with groups of 8 bits separated by a dot. This numbering scheme is also known as dotted-decimal notation. Each 8-bit group represents numbers from 0 to 255. An example of an IPv4 IP address is 113.19.12.102. Also see IPv4 and IPv6.
Network Number
The portion of an IP address that represents which network the computer is on.
WLAN
Stands for Wireless Local Area Network, it is a network that allows devices to connect and communicate wirelessly within a limited area like a home, school, or office building.
DHCP
Dynamic Host Configuration Protocol, a network management protocol used to automate the process of configuring devices on IP networks, assigning unique IP addresses to each device.
